| ensureNS("jQuery.mobile.tizen.clrlib"); |
| |
| jQuery.extend( jQuery.mobile.tizen.clrlib, |
| { |
| nearestInt: function(val) { |
| var theFloor = Math.floor(val); |
| |
| return (((val - theFloor) > 0.5) ? (theFloor + 1) : theFloor); |
| }, |
| |
| /* |
| * Converts html color string to rgb array. |
| * |
| * Input: string clr_str, where |
| * clr_str is of the form "#aabbcc" |
| * |
| * Returns: [ r, g, b ], where |
| * r is in [0, 1] |
| * g is in [0, 1] |
| * b is in [0, 1] |
| */ |
| HTMLToRGB: function(clr_str) { |
| clr_str = (('#' == clr_str.charAt(0)) ? clr_str.substring(1) : clr_str); |
| |
| return ([ |
| clr_str.substring(0, 2), |
| clr_str.substring(2, 4), |
| clr_str.substring(4, 6) |
| ].map(function(val) { |
| return parseInt(val, 16) / 255.0; |
| })); |
| }, |
| |
| /* |
| * Converts rgb array to html color string. |
| * |
| * Input: [ r, g, b ], where |
| * r is in [0, 1] |
| * g is in [0, 1] |
| * b is in [0, 1] |
| * |
| * Returns: string of the form "#aabbcc" |
| */ |
| RGBToHTML: function(rgb) { |
| return ("#" + |
| rgb.map(function(val) { |
| var ret = val * 255, |
| theFloor = Math.floor(ret); |
| |
| ret = ((ret - theFloor > 0.5) ? (theFloor + 1) : theFloor); |
| ret = (((ret < 16) ? "0" : "") + (ret & 0xff).toString(16)); |
| return ret; |
| }) |
| .join("")); |
| }, |
| |
| /* |
| * Converts hsl to rgb. |
| * |
| * From http://130.113.54.154/~monger/hsl-rgb.html |
| * |
| * Input: [ h, s, l ], where |
| * h is in [0, 360] |
| * s is in [0, 1] |
| * l is in [0, 1] |
| * |
| * Returns: [ r, g, b ], where |
| * r is in [0, 1] |
| * g is in [0, 1] |
| * b is in [0, 1] |
| */ |
| HSLToRGB: function(hsl) { |
| var h = hsl[0] / 360.0, s = hsl[1], l = hsl[2]; |
| |
| if (0 === s) |
| return [ l, l, l ]; |
| |
| var temp2 = ((l < 0.5) |
| ? l * (1.0 + s) |
| : l + s - l * s), |
| temp1 = 2.0 * l - temp2, |
| temp3 = { |
| r: h + 1.0 / 3.0, |
| g: h, |
| b: h - 1.0 / 3.0 |
| }; |
| |
| temp3.r = ((temp3.r < 0) ? (temp3.r + 1.0) : ((temp3.r > 1) ? (temp3.r - 1.0) : temp3.r)); |
| temp3.g = ((temp3.g < 0) ? (temp3.g + 1.0) : ((temp3.g > 1) ? (temp3.g - 1.0) : temp3.g)); |
| temp3.b = ((temp3.b < 0) ? (temp3.b + 1.0) : ((temp3.b > 1) ? (temp3.b - 1.0) : temp3.b)); |
| |
| ret = [ |
| (((6.0 * temp3.r) < 1) ? (temp1 + (temp2 - temp1) * 6.0 * temp3.r) : |
| (((2.0 * temp3.r) < 1) ? temp2 : |
| (((3.0 * temp3.r) < 2) ? (temp1 + (temp2 - temp1) * ((2.0 / 3.0) - temp3.r) * 6.0) : |
| temp1))), |
| (((6.0 * temp3.g) < 1) ? (temp1 + (temp2 - temp1) * 6.0 * temp3.g) : |
| (((2.0 * temp3.g) < 1) ? temp2 : |
| (((3.0 * temp3.g) < 2) ? (temp1 + (temp2 - temp1) * ((2.0 / 3.0) - temp3.g) * 6.0) : |
| temp1))), |
| (((6.0 * temp3.b) < 1) ? (temp1 + (temp2 - temp1) * 6.0 * temp3.b) : |
| (((2.0 * temp3.b) < 1) ? temp2 : |
| (((3.0 * temp3.b) < 2) ? (temp1 + (temp2 - temp1) * ((2.0 / 3.0) - temp3.b) * 6.0) : |
| temp1)))]; |
| |
| return ret; |
| }, |
| |
| /* |
| * Converts hsv to rgb. |
| * |
| * Input: [ h, s, v ], where |
| * h is in [0, 360] |
| * s is in [0, 1] |
| * v is in [0, 1] |
| * |
| * Returns: [ r, g, b ], where |
| * r is in [0, 1] |
| * g is in [0, 1] |
| * b is in [0, 1] |
| */ |
| HSVToRGB: function(hsv) { |
| return $.mobile.tizen.clrlib.HSLToRGB($.mobile.tizen.clrlib.HSVToHSL(hsv)); |
| }, |
| |
| /* |
| * Converts rgb to hsv. |
| * |
| * from http://coecsl.ece.illinois.edu/ge423/spring05/group8/FinalProject/HSV_writeup.pdf |
| * |
| * Input: [ r, g, b ], where |
| * r is in [0, 1] |
| * g is in [0, 1] |
| * b is in [0, 1] |
| * |
| * Returns: [ h, s, v ], where |
| * h is in [0, 360] |
| * s is in [0, 1] |
| * v is in [0, 1] |
| */ |
| RGBToHSV: function(rgb) { |
| var min, max, delta, h, s, v, r = rgb[0], g = rgb[1], b = rgb[2]; |
| |
| min = Math.min(r, Math.min(g, b)); |
| max = Math.max(r, Math.max(g, b)); |
| delta = max - min; |
| |
| h = 0; |
| s = 0; |
| v = max; |
| |
| if (delta > 0.00001) { |
| s = delta / max; |
| |
| if (r === max) |
| h = (g - b) / delta ; |
| else |
| if (g === max) |
| h = 2 + (b - r) / delta ; |
| else |
| h = 4 + (r - g) / delta ; |
| |
| h *= 60 ; |
| |
| if (h < 0) |
| h += 360 ; |
| } |
| |
| return [h, s, v]; |
| }, |
| |
| /* |
| * Converts hsv to hsl. |
| * |
| * Input: [ h, s, v ], where |
| * h is in [0, 360] |
| * s is in [0, 1] |
| * v is in [0, 1] |
| * |
| * Returns: [ h, s, l ], where |
| * h is in [0, 360] |
| * s is in [0, 1] |
| * l is in [0, 1] |
| */ |
| HSVToHSL: function(hsv) { |
| var max = hsv[2], |
| delta = hsv[1] * max, |
| min = max - delta, |
| sum = max + min, |
| half_sum = sum / 2, |
| s_divisor = ((half_sum < 0.5) ? sum : (2 - max - min)); |
| |
| return [ hsv[0], ((0 == s_divisor) ? 0 : (delta / s_divisor)), half_sum ]; |
| }, |
| |
| /* |
| * Converts rgb to hsl |
| * |
| * Input: [ r, g, b ], where |
| * r is in [0, 1] |
| * g is in [0, 1] |
| * b is in [0, 1] |
| * |
| * Returns: [ h, s, l ], where |
| * h is in [0, 360] |
| * s is in [0, 1] |
| * l is in [0, 1] |
| */ |
| RGBToHSL: function(rgb) { |
| return $.mobile.tizen.clrlib.HSVToHSL($.mobile.tizen.clrlib.RGBToHSV(rgb)); |
| } |
| }); |
